According to the public record, 21, Cherry Trees, Henlow is an early-century freehold house with 1,054 ft2 of internal area.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 21, Cherry Trees, Henlow is £382,537 and the estimated rental value is £1,589 per month.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 21, Cherry Trees, Henlow is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£401,664 and a rental value of £1,668 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£355,759 and a rental value of £1,478 per month.
Over the past 12 months, the estimated sale value of 21, Cherry Trees, Henlow has fallen by £6,880 (1.8%), while its estimated rental value has moved up by £39 per month (2.5%). Based on current estimates, the property offers a gross rental yield of 5.0%.
21, Cherry Trees, Henlow has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 16 Apr 2012.
The property is not conn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
According to HM Land Registry, 21, Cherry Trees, Henlow was last sold on 15th March 2021 for £324,000 and was recorded as a freehold house.
The property has had 2 sales since 1995.
